Our Model

You see, we aren’t your typical real-money online poker site. We don’t take deposits so you won’t find any gambling on our site. We also aren’t your typical social online poker platform. Those sites make their money selling you worthless virtual currency while giving you zero opportunity to win anything of value in return.

What we offer is a FREE online poker network with  the opportunity to compete to win real cash and prizes. How do we fund these cash tournaments if we aren’t taking your money? Well, it’s via sponsorships from our advertisers. So if we eliminate or cut back on the ads, then we’d have to eliminate or cut back on our prize pool. And how much would you still enjoy our site if we took away the prizes?  We like to think it’s what makes us unique and helps  differentiate us from all the other poker sites. But we’ve digressed…

  1. Ensure that your desktop or laptop was born this decade

Please don’t point the finger at us if you’re still using Windows XP and trying to play on NLOP using Internet Explorer 6! For PC and Mac users, we highly recommend that you use the Google Chrome browser for the best poker experience. If you’re on a PC, make sure you’re using Windows 10 or Windows 8. Even Windows 7 will work, but if you’re still on Windows Vista or Windows XP, it’s time for an upgrade.

  1. Check your internet connection

If you’re playing from a dial-up modem or 2G cellular connection, chances are our site won’t work very well. We recommend a download speed of at least 5 Mbps. You can check your internet speed by clicking here.
